Westhead Lathom St James’ Church of England Primary School

16 School Lane, Westhead, Ormskirk, Lancashire L40 6HL

10 reasons to choose Westhead Lathom St James' Church of England Primary School

Top line

Westhead Lathom St James’ Church of England Primary School has a Schoolsmith Score® of 71. It is one of the best state primary schools in Ormskirk and one of the 10 best independent or state primaries within 7 miles.

School fundamentals

Westhead Lathom St James’ Church of England Primary School is a state primary school for boys and girls (50%/50%) between the ages of 3 and 11 years. It is a Church of England voluntary controlled faith school. Though Ofsted no longer makes an an overall effectiveness judgement, its graded judgements imply an Outstanding rating for the school in its last (2025) inspection. Reception places are usually oversubscribed every year, on first preference.

Average class size

Westhead Lathom St James’ Church of England Primary School has four mixed-age classes and an average class size of 24 pupils.

Exam results and leavers' destinations

Average Year 6 SATS results from 2016-19 and 2022 show that Westhead Lathom St James’ Church of England Primary School ranks in the top 10% of schools in the country by attainment. By the same measure, progress score rank the school in the top 21% of schools. Most pupils go on to Ormskirk School at the end of Year 6.

The Westhead Lathom St James' Church of England Primary School curriculum

School curriculum emphasises Christian social morality and also includes PSHE, Spanish. Subjects are taught separately and are organised by topics, with cross-curricular linking where appropriate. The school offers each pupil over 5 different extra-curricular academic activities or hobby clubs.

More on the curriculum

There are regular educational trips for all year groups, visiting speakers, Forest School for all year groups and a residential trip for Years 5 and 6.

Specialist teaching

Most lessons are taught by the class teacher with some peripatetic and specialist teaching.

Sport at Westhead Lathom St James' Church of England Primary School

School offers PE and up to 10 seasonal sports. Representative teams in some sports from Year 3.

The Arts at Westhead Lathom St James' Church of England Primary School

Art and music are taught as discrete subjects to all pupils. DT, drama, dance integrated into other subjects. Choir. There may be an occasional extra-curricular performing arts or arts & crafts club.

Wraparound care

Out of school hours care from 8.00am to 5.30pm.
